Woman facing social boycott dies by suicide
India, March 17 -- A 46-year-old woman allegedly died by suicide in Karnataka's Yadgir district after her family allegedly faced prolonged social boycott after community leaders accused her son of having an extramarital relationship with a pregnant woman from the same community, police said. The body of the woman, from Girinagar in Yadgir district, was recovered by fire and emergency services personnel on Sunday afternoon. Wadgera Police sub-inspector Maheboob Ali said the boycott had been imposed by leaders of the Sillekyata community and reportedly affected the family's livelihood.
